1.What happens to the Angle of Refraction as the medium becomes denser? Explain why.

Respuesta :

Xema8 Xema8
  • 17-02-2021

Answer:

Explanation:

If angle of incidence and angle of refraction be i   and r respectively ,

sini / sinr = μ ( refractive index )

sin r = sin i / μ

If angle of incidence i be constant and medium becomes denser that means μ becomes higher in value , the value of sin r will be low ( because of increase in value of denominator )

As sin r decreases , r also decreases also.

Hence when medium becomes denser , angle of refraction becomes less .
